The article discusses Union Pacific Railroad's focus on freight-car velocity as a key performance indicator. By increasing velocity, the railroad reduces costs and improves service, leading to a lower operating ratio and higher earnings. The thesis suggests that maintaining velocity in the mid-200s miles per car per day will enhance profitability. Union Pacific's strategic focus on reliability and operational efficiency has led to significant financial gains, with a projected $6 billion free cash flow in 2024.
